摘要
The measurement of fine particle size is important in spray systems, minimum quantity lubrication, and weather observation. Introducing the recent progress of imaging techniques, the authors developed a portable measurement system. To overcome the large light intensity difference between the incident laser light and diffracted light and the limitation of the dynamic range of imaging devices, the event correlation was adopted. The growth of droplets in fog was experimentally measured. (C) 2016 The Japan Society of Applied Physics
